The Role:
You'll get to work across our categories in a series of rotations designed to give you breadth and depth of knowledge, exposure to industry experts and develop a whole host of skills.
You will have the opportunity to do three placements within our Integrated Supply Chain function. Within each placement you will have significant responsibilities that play a key role in achieving operational goals and working on business projects. The variety of the placements will provide the foundations for a career across Integrated Supply Chain.
Placements may include:- Customer Collaboration - working with our top retail customers, managing and developing relationships.
- Demand Planning - creating an accurate forecast of our upcoming demand across retailers and categories to drive product availability.
- Supply Planning - working with manufacturing to create a supply plan that balances product availability with inventory management and cost.
- Logistics - maximising the performance of our transport and warehousing operations.
- Product Change Management - Work with, and influence, multiple supply chain stakeholders to develop and deliver projects such as new products launches and packaging design changes.

Healthcare Strength — Health coverage and wellness offerings are broad in U.S. postings, including medical, dental, vision, EAP, wellness programs, and fertility support; some roles note coverage effective on start date or soon after. One manufacturing posting cited employees paying roughly 7% of premiums, which is described as favorable versus many employers.
-
Retirement Support — U.S. roles consistently reference a 401(k) with company matching (e.g., “3% on 6% invested”), and some union positions reference additional retirement or pension benefits under collective agreements. Separate salaried materials describe company contributions up to 9% with vesting after two years.
-
Parental & Family Support — A published global parental‑leave standard sets minimums worldwide, including adoptive and foster parents, with U.S. materials indicating paid bonding leave for all caregivers. This signals sustained emphasis on family support across markets, with local specifics determined by role and location.

What We Do
Mondelēz International, Inc. (NASDAQ: MDLZ) is an American multinational confectionery, food, and beverage company based in Illinois which employs approximately 90,000 individuals around the world. Our Purpose Our purpose is to empower people to snack right. We will lead the future of snacking around the world by offering the right snack, for the right moment, made the right way. Our Brands We’re leading the future of snacking with iconic brands such as Oreo, belVita and LU biscuits; Cadbury Dairy Milk, Milka and Toblerone chocolate; Sour Patch Kids candy and Trident gum.
